- Biography:
- Eighteen-year-old African American sophomore at the University of Wisconsin-Whitewater shot in the neck and killed by police during a Milwaukee, Wisconsin riot on August 2, 1967. The police claimed that McKissick and three other youths had tried to set fire to a building with Molotov cocktails; McKissick's family and several neighbors claimed, however, that he had been sitting on the front porch when all of a sudden everyone heard gunshots. Everyone, including McKissick, ran. Father James Groppi spoke at McKissick's funeral.
